Volleyball is actually a sport that calls for coordination, communication, and a robust understanding of Every single player’s position within the court. With six gamers on all sides, Just about every situation has precise obligations that lead to the overall technique and effectiveness of the team. Whether or not you’re a beginner trying to understand the basic principles or possibly a admirer eager to follow the video game a lot more closely, Mastering the principle volleyball positions is key to appreciating the Activity.
The sport is usually performed in the rotation method, this means players shift clockwise with the 6 positions within the court docket. These contain a few front-row positions (positions 2, three, and 4) and 3 back again-row positions (positions one, six, and five). In spite of rotating, gamers generally focus on 1 situation and perform their Principal roles regardless of their area during the rotation.
The setter is usually often called the playmaker. Their job is to touch the ball on just about every offensive Engage in and established it up for attackers. The setter requires Outstanding hand capabilities, eyesight, and conclusion-creating. Positioned while in the entrance or back again suitable of the court, the setter runs the offense, deciding who gets the ball and when. An excellent setter can read through the opposing blockers and make scoring alternatives even stressed.
The skin hitter, also known as the remaining-facet hitter, is typically the team's most constant attacker. Outdoors hitters tend to be relied upon to strike significant balls and score from the two the front and back court docket. They have to be sturdy all-all around players, excelling at attacking, provide get, and defense.
The alternative hitter, also known as the best-side hitter, performs across in the setter. Their primary position is to block the opponent’s outside hitter and assault from the correct side. Reverse hitters need to be potent and functional given that they frequently facial area another team’s finest hitters and so are referred to as on to attain details in substantial-pressure predicaments. They also may well get around environment obligations when the setter can make the very first Get hold of.
The middle blocker plays in the center entrance and is crucial to both of those the group’s offensive speedy assaults and its defensive blocking technique. Middle blockers have to have fast footwork, exceptional timing, and powerful vertical jumps to halt opposing attacks and execute quick-paced hits of their unique. They’re usually the tallest players within the crew and need to be ready to move side to side along the net.
The libero is actually a specialized defensive player who wears a distinct shade jersey and can't Enjoy from the entrance row or assault the ball earlier mentioned Internet peak. The libero replaces back again-row players to improve the group’s serve receive and digging. Agile and speedy, liberos Perform a significant job in maintaining control throughout rallies and extending performs.
The defensive expert is an additional back-row participant that's subbed in for selected rotations to improve defense and passing. In contrast to the libero, they are able to provide and assault from powering the 10-foot line.
Alongside one another, these positions sort the backbone of any volleyball group, each contributing unique competencies that, when executed very well, produce a dynamic and effective device within the court.
